"Henrietta Maria" is a captivating historical novel that delves into the life of Henrietta Maria of France, the queen consort of Charles I of England. The narrative explores her struggles and triumphs as she navigates the turbulent political landscape of 17th-century England. Through rich character development and vivid descriptions, the author brings to life the complexities of royal duty, personal sacrifice, and the impact of civil war on the monarchy. Readers are drawn into Henrietta's world, experiencing her passion, resilience, and the challenges she faces as a foreign queen in a divided kingdom.***In "Henrietta Haynes," the story shifts focus to a contemporary character named Henrietta Haynes, who embarks on a journey of self-discovery and empowerment. Set against a backdrop of modern societal challenges, the novel explores themes of identity, belonging, and the quest for personal fulfillment. Henrietta's character is relatable and inspiring, as she confronts her past and seeks to carve out her own path in life. The author skillfully intertwines Henrietta's personal growth with broader social issues, making this a poignant and thought-provoking read.
